In the beginning, the humidity of the air leaving the dryer may be very higher as a result of evaporation of drinking water in the granules all through drying. As the granules dry, the more info humidity on the outlet air decreases and the tip-point of drying takes place once the humidity in the inlet and outlet air approach precisely the same benefit. Moist bulb temperatures, having said that, are tough to measure as it is actually tricky to preserve a forever saturated moist wick. Yet another drawback of temperature-centered monitoring methods is restricted precision as a result of very poor fluidization disorders throughout the bed.

In the case of FBDs, a stream of hot air or fuel is passed click here by way of a bed of solid particles, creating them to be suspended and act similar to a boiling fluid. This fluidized point out permits effective heat transfer and uniform drying of the material.

Mild Handling: The fluidized point out with the particles lessens the chance of item degradation or damage all through drying.
